Do not place too many flowers on the tables at your wedding reception. The flowers will often just get in the way when your guests are trying to eat. There are some guests that have allergies to flowers, as well. Adorn the tables with romantic, non-scented candles instead.

Make sure your wedding reception lighting can be dimmed at the venue. While this might seem like a little detail, a lower light for the first dance is always preferable, while you will want things a little brighter during the speeches part of the ceremony. Check out the lighting available at different venues before picking one.

When young children are in the wedding party, make sure they are dressed in clothing that is comfortable for them. Dress them in soft, comfortable fabrics that are airy and fit loosely. If they are going to have new shoes, you should let them wear them a few times before the ceremony to break them in. Taking care of these small details will allow children to focus on participation in the wedding instead of fussing with their attire.

Getting a relative or friend ordained online can give him authority to officiate the wedding ceremony. Doing so allows for individual customization of your personal ceremony, and it can also save you having to spend money on an officiant. But do not mar this important day by breaking the law; verify that it is permitted in your region.
